ECFP
ECFP stands for Extended-Connectivity Fingerprints, a class of binary molecular fingerprints widely used in cheminformatics to encode structural information for similarity searching and machine learning. They are based on circular substructures centered on each atom and grown outward to a fixed radius, capturing local neighborhoods rather than entire molecular graphs.
